Audi’s dwelling town of Ingolstadt, Germany, houses the brand’s formal history museum, which is open up to people, alongside with a shipping center and company offices. You will find also a lesser-recognized building that is usually not open up to the public. It properties the Audi Tradition motor vehicles. They consist of 726 cars and trucks and some 200 motorcycles and include retired Le Mans racers and rally automobiles, early Sport Quattros, and the to start with left-hand-push motor vehicle in Germany (in 1928). A row of Audi Activity Quattros, together with this 1984 illustration, was specially spectacular. This Group B rallying homologation specific was radically reworked from the typical coupe Quattro, with much more than a foot chopped out of the wheelbase, an aluminum 2.1-liter five-cylinder turbo superior for 302 horsepower, and broader wheels below blistered fenders. It was the most high priced German car or truck when released and can fetch extra than $500,000 nowadays.
The very first 8-cylinder Audi, the Form R 19-100 was nicknamed “Imperator” (“Emperor”). Its side-valve 4.9-liter straight-eight designed 100 horsepower, but only 147 have been developed in 1928 and ’29.
The two-doorway Audi 80 wagon, created from 1966 to 1968, was a up to date of the Volkswagen Squareback, but with its powertrain at the entrance somewhat than the rear. This is a ’67 design.
In the Automobile Union spouse and children of manufacturers, Wanderer was a midlevel supplying, and it ambitiously went after the BMW 328 with its W25K roadster. The “K” for “Kompressor” denotes a supercharged motor that was great for 85 horsepower but also regarded for its mechanical fragility. Even with the swoopy styling, only 260 ended up offered involving 1936 and 1938.
This sporting model of the Audi 80 highlighted a gasoline-injected 1.6-liter motor superior for 108 horsepower. That engine would go on to power the initial-gen Volkswagen GTI.
DKW generally built bikes, but in the early Thirties it branched out into cars like this roadster, which claimed to be the initially mass-created entrance-wheel-generate car or truck. It used a 600-cc bike motor and had a straightforward wooden human body.
Audi Motorsport was recognized in 1978, initially for the reason of rallying. This is the initial Quattro rally automobile, which was employed as a chase vehicle in the 1980 Algarve rally. It really proved to be 30 minutes more quickly than the rally winner.
The DKW Schnellaster was the very first Vehicle Union products built right after the War, starting in 1949—predating the Volkswagen Bulli. The identify, which translates to “quick transporter,” was anything of a misnomer, presented the two-cylinder, two-cycle engine up entrance, sending 20 horsepower (later on 22 hp) to the entrance wheels.
Constructed from 1994 to 1995, the RS2 wagon kicked off Audi’s RS line of ultra-substantial-performance autos. A joint exertion with Porsche and assembled in Zuffenhausen, all RS2s were being wagons and were being run by a turbocharged inline-5 producing 311 horsepower. Most were blue, silver, crimson, or black, but any Porsche shade could be had, which includes this putting inexperienced.
Of the 4 Car Union makes, Horsch stood at the prime with imposing machines like this 853 A. “A” for autobahn, signifying an overdrive transmission, which was paired with a 4.9-liter straight-eight that was excellent for 120 horsepower. The model was a rival to the Mercedes-Benz 540K.
